About 'Nitnem': -

Nit-Nem (literally Daily Naam) is a collaboration of different banis that were designated to be read by Sikhs every day at different times of the day. Sikhs read nitnems at Gurdwaras. The Nit-Nem bani's usually include the Panj bania (5 bani'below) which are read daily by baptized Sikhs in the morning between 3:00 am and 6:00 am (this period is considered as Amrit Vela or the Ambrosial Hours) and 'Rehras Sahib' in the evening 6pm and 'Kirtan Sohila' at night 9pm.

1. 'Japji Sahib' (amritvela)
2. 'Jaap Sahib' (amritvela)
3. 'Tav-Prasad' Savaiye(morning)
4. 'Chaupai Sahib' (morning)
5. 'Anand Sahib' (All 40 Shabads) (morning)
6. 'Rehras Sahib' (evening)
7. 'Kirtan Sohila' (night)

The 5 morning Banis are usually recited in the early morning while Rehras is read in the evening (around 6pm.) and Kirtan Sohila is recited just before going to sleep at night. More prayers may be added to the Sikh's liking.
